epic backlink guide - An Overview

Because we’ve worked with many hundreds of manufacturers to further improve their Search engine optimisation, the most significant pitfall is lack of persistence. It might take 3 months, 6 months, a year as well as three yrs depending on the competitiveness of one's sector.The reality is always that SEOs are skeptical about creating links. T

read more